Abstract/Summary
Petasis and Ugi reactions are used successively without intermediate purification, effectively accomplishing a six-component reaction. The examined reactions are transferred from traditional batch reactors to an automated continuous flow microreactor setup, where optimization and kinetic analyses are performed, proposed mechanisms evaluated, and rate-limiting steps determined.
